Supported Learning assessment support material

Resources and guidance for this domain

These support materials include assessor guidelines and ākonga/learner guidelines, and contain general information, assessment tasks, and sample answers, that reflect the outcomes of the Supported Learning unit standards.

They are intended as a guide, not teaching plans. It is expected that assessors will adapt them in a way that is relevant to the context in which their assessment occurs.

The standards are intended for people with learning disabilities, including those with intellectual disabilities, who require some form of support with their learning, either through additional resources, specialised equipment or adapted teaching programmes.
